Homemade Beef Cheddar Melt: Arby’s-Inspired Comfort Sandwich

1. Prepare the Arby’s-Style Sauce

In a small bowl, whisk together ketchup, brown sugar, apple cider v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, and onion powder.

Set aside to allow flavors to meld.

2. Make the Cheddar Cheese Sauce

Melt butter in a small saucepan over medium heat.

Stir in flour and cook for 1 minute, stirring constantly until foamy.

Gradually pour in milk while whisking, simmering until thickened (about 5 minutes).

Remove from heat and stir in shredded cheddar until smooth.

3. Warm the Roast Beef

Add beef broth to a skillet and bring to a simmer.

Separate roast beef slices to avoid clumping and warm in batches for 1–2 minutes.

Lift out with tongs and drain.

4. Assemble the Sandwiches

Spread Arby’s-style sauce on the bottom half of each bun.

Layer on warm roast beef.

Drizzle generously with cheddar cheese sauce.

Top with the other bun half and serve immediately.
